WebFor Florida Incorporation, state law requires a business to file Articles of Incorporation with the Division of Corporations. There are $70 in combined fees to incorporate in Florida (a $35 filing fee plus a $35 registered agent designation fee). The document can be mailed, faxed, hand delivered or filed online at the DOC website. WebJun 20, 2016 · Code Sections. Florida Statutes Chapter 607: Florida Business Corporation Act. Formation. In order to form a corporation, a document must satisfy the requirements of Florida corporation laws and must be filed in the office of the Department of State.
